summ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Dan Sandler <dsandler@android.com> 2018-01-24 23:20:18 -0500
committer Dan Sandler <dsandler@android.com> 2018-01-24 23:22:13 -0500
commit83b70a00d66fe127d0d02fe38bd7a6101567e69d (patch)
tree13fea4a91eab340d0db64795f33b8dfeb07df730
parentd12ad36399e271b00d3aa0e98e07c2321e5fd0b2 (diff)
Apply user sentiment on ranking update.
Bug: 63095540 Test: swipe away a notification four times in a row Test: runtest systemui Change-Id: Ie0c913b1c33a02f866819b80607ee0c6232bc8f9
-rw-r--r--packages/SystemUI/src/com/android/systemui/statusbar/NotificationViewHierarchyManager.java4
1 files changed, 4 insertions, 0 deletions
diff --git a/packages/SystemUI/src/com/android/systemui/statusbar/NotificationViewHierarchyManager.java b/packages/SystemUI/src/com/android/systemui/statusbar/NotificationViewHierarchyManager.java
index 266c09bc6c8d..cd4c7ae8d57e 100644
--- a/packages/SystemUI/src/com/android/systemui/statusbar/NotificationViewHierarchyManager.java
+++ b/packages/SystemUI/src/com/android/systemui/statusbar/NotificationViewHierarchyManager.java
@@ -18,6 +18,7 @@ package com.android.systemui.statusbar;
import android.content.Context;
import android.content.res.Resources;
+import android.service.notification.NotificationListenerService;
import android.util.Log;
import android.view.View;
import android.view.ViewGroup;
@@ -338,6 +339,9 @@ public class NotificationViewHierarchyManager {
stack.push(notificationChildren.get(i));
}
}
+
+ row.showBlockingHelper(entry.userSentiment ==
+ NotificationListenerService.Ranking.USER_SENTIMENT_NEGATIVE);
}
mPresenter.onUpdateRowStates();